description The legend of Mahsuri is the prototype tale of the virtuous wife who has been wronged by nobility, due to gossip, ill-will and the abuse of power. Up till the late-80s, it was said that the island of Langkawi was put under a curse for seven generations by Mahsuri, which is why it could never develop. This is the story that can give a lot of moralistic for people especially teenager and adult. But now days, they don't adapt about this moralistic story through their life and think this is just a myths for our culture. Although The legendary of Mahsuri is the one famous story in Malaysia, but now days it become slowly forgotten and disappear from the soul of our youth. Unfortunately, many people have a lot version of story about Mahsuri and that can make people especially student or youth generation become slowly untrust and forgotten about this legend. In their story, they specify on the superficial aspects, instead of functional and historical aspects of the legendary stories.It is the purpose of this paper to explore about perception and awamess people especially among student about The Legends of Mahsuri to prove that awareness about this legends slowly dissapears and forgotten and it will give some recommendation how to make The Legends of Mahsuri will not being forgotten for our next generation to make it always being reminder about this legendary.
